Precipitation Seasonality (Coefficient of Variation) (Bioclim 15) from 1976-2005 at 9s / 250m resolution - CSIRO Data Access Portal
Notes: Percentage of precipitation variability, where largest percentages represent greater variability of precipitation. Part of collection 9s climatology for continental Australia 1976-2005: BIOCLIM variable suite. Collection description A suite of 9s resolution BIOCLIM climate surfaces for the Australian continent. This collection represents a 30 year average centred on 1990 for the standard set of 35 BIOCLIM variables. Data are provided as zipped ESRI float grids: Binary float grids (*.flt) with associated ESRI header files (*.hdr) and projection files (*.prj). After extracting from the zip archive, these files can be imported into most GIS software packages, and can be used as other binary file formats by substituting the appropriate header file. Additionally a short methods summary is provided in the file 9sClimateMethodsSummary.pdf for further information, including a nomenclature for files. Start date 1976-01-01 End date 2005-12-31 Access The metadata and files (if any) are available to the public. Lineage BIOCLIM climate surfaces for the present were calculated in the ANUCLIM 6.1 (Xu and Hutchinson, 2011) 30 year average climate surfaces for Australia (1976-2005), with elevational lapse rate correction applied over the 9s GEODATA digital elevation model (Hutchinson et al , 2008).
